concept

Audit Trails

Audit trails are systematic records that log chronological sequences of activities, events, or changes in a system, application, or database to provide accountability, traceability, and security. They capture details such as who performed an action, what was done, when it occurred, and sometimes why, often used for compliance, debugging, and forensic analysis. In software development, they are implemented to monitor user interactions, data modifications, and system operations.

Also known as: Audit Logs, Audit Logging, Change Logs, Activity Logs, Audit Records
🧊Why learn Audit Trails?

Developers should implement audit trails when building systems that require regulatory compliance (e.g., HIPAA, GDPR, SOX), security monitoring, or debugging complex issues, as they help track unauthorized access, data breaches, and operational errors. They are essential in financial applications, healthcare systems, and enterprise software to ensure transparency, support audits, and facilitate incident response by providing a historical record of actions.

Compare Audit Trails

Learning Resources

Related Tools

Alternatives to Audit Trails